JACKSON, Ga. - Strapped to a gurney in Georgia's death chamber, Troy Davis lifted his head and declared one last time that he did not kill police officer Mark MacPhail. Just a few feet away behind a glass window, MacPhail's son and brother watched in silence.
Outside the prison, a crowd of more than 500 demonstrators cried, hugged, prayed and held candles. They represented hundreds of thousands of supporters worldwide who took up the anti-death penalty cause as Davis' final days ticked away.

Davis was convicted in 1991 of killing MacPhail, who was working as a security guard at the time. MacPhail rushed to the aid of a homeless man who prosecutors said Davis was bashing with a handgun after asking him for a beer. Prosecutors said Davis had a smirk on his face as he shot the officer to death in a Burger King parking lot in Savannah.
No gun was ever found, but prosecutors say shell casings were linked to an earlier shooting for which Davis was convicted.
Witnesses placed Davis at the crime scene and identified him as the shooter, but several of them have recanted their accounts and some jurors have said they've changed their minds about his guilt. Others have claimed a man who was with Davis that night has told people he actually shot the officer.

DETROIT -- Detroit police Chief Ralph Godbee says he expects more officers to be on the streets after a 24-hour period that was packed with gun violence and left six people dead and nine wounded around the city.

Godbee told Local 4 News Morning in a telephone interview Monday that changes could double the number of officers on the streets during the typically busy period of the day for police between 8 p.m. and 8 a.m.

“It’ll get the community, the good hardworking people who do it right every day, a boost of confidence to a see of number of officers out deployed,” Godbee said.(Click on Detroit Sept 13).

Godbee says staffing details are being worked out with union officials.





  • Watch: DPD Plans To Stop Wave Of Violence











  • Police say the shootings happened at nine locations between 6 a.m. Friday and 6 a.m. Saturday. They come amid an increase in homicides from last year.

    Detroit Mayor Dave Bing said in a statement over the weekend that reducing violent crime is his administration's top goal.

         The embarrassing messages between Kilpatrick and Christine Beatty from 2002 and 2003 appear in an 18-page document released Tuesday on the orders of Wayne County Circuit Court Judge Robert J. Colombo Jr. in response to a lawsuit by the Detroit Free Press and The Detroit News.
         The document was obtained from the computer of Michael Stefani, an attorney who represented three police officers in whistle-blowers' lawsuits against the city that were settled last year for $8.4 million. The text messages were taken from Beatty's city-issued pagers.The messages could prove damaging to Kilpatrick and Beatty, who are accused of lying under oath in one of the lawsuits by denying they had an intimate relationship. They are charged with perjury, misconduct and obstruction of justice. Both have denied wrongdoing.
         The document released Tuesday includes descriptions of sexual trysts, the frequent use of the N-word by the mayor and Beatty as a term of endearment, and discussions of marriage.
